A Leipzig Water Jousting Badge, 1934 Auction rare badge with this makerA 1934 Leipzig Fischerstechen badge (4. 10. 1934); In die stamped gilt metal, horizontal pin on reverse; unmarked; measuring 44 mm x 35 mm; better than fine condition. Footnote: Fischestechen (Water jousting) is a traditional German Swiss form of jousting where adversaries carry a lance, standing on a platform on the stern of a small bat. The aim of the sport is to send the adversary into the water while maintaining ones own balance on the platform.
